Dependency Ratios for Winnebago County, Iowa

Total Dependency Ratio:
76.0
Youth Dependency:
37.1
Old-Age Dependency:
38.9

The dependency ratio measures dependents (ages 0-17 and 65+) per 100 working-age individuals (ages 18-64).
